CA 2449355

A roll-up curtain assembly includes plural, vertically spaced, horizontal roll- up rods extending across an opening. Each roll-up rod is coupled to a respective flexible curtain section and an electric motor. Actuation of the electric motor in a first direction of rotation causes rotation of the roll-up rod in a first direction for rolling the flexible curtain section onto the rod and moving the curtain assembly to the retracted, or open, position. Actuation of the electric motor in a second, opposed direction of rotation lowers the roll-up rod resulting in an unwinding of the curtain section from the rod allowing the curtain assembly to assume the extended, or closed, position. Plural vertically spaced curtain sections each having a respective motor/roll-up rod combination are coupled together and move upward or downward in unison.
